How to fill out Client Record - Body Piercing Informed Consent
01
Start with the client's full name and contact information.
02
Specify the date of the procedure.
03
Include details about the piercing site and type of jewelry to be used.
04
Outline the risks associated with body piercing, including possible infections or complications.
05
Obtain the client's medical history relevant to the procedure.
06
Clearly state the aftercare instructions and importance of following them.
07
Obtain the client's signature to confirm understanding and consent.

What is Client Record - Body Piercing Informed Consent?
The Client Record - Body Piercing Informed Consent is a document that outlines the risks, benefits, and procedures associated with body piercing, ensuring that clients are fully informed before consenting to the procedure.
Who is required to file Client Record - Body Piercing Informed Consent?
Body piercing professionals and studios are required to file the Client Record - Body Piercing Informed Consent for each client undergoing a piercing procedure.
How to fill out Client Record - Body Piercing Informed Consent?
To fill out the Client Record - Body Piercing Informed Consent, the professional must provide detailed information regarding the procedure, obtain the client's personal information, and ensure that the client understands the risks involved, followed by the client's signature indicating consent.
What is the purpose of Client Record - Body Piercing Informed Consent?
The purpose of the Client Record - Body Piercing Informed Consent is to legally protect both the client and the professional by documenting that the client is informed about the procedure and willingly consents to it.
What information must be reported on Client Record - Body Piercing Informed Consent?
The information that must be reported includes the client's name, date of birth, contact information, details of the piercing procedure, risks involved, aftercare instructions, and the client's signature indicating informed consent.
